John Bush was a train porter living in Lakeview (now #Mississauga) from around 1923 to until his death in 1948. Read more about him and two other residents: archive.org/details/thre...

Tin types like this are among the earliest photographs in our collection. This is an unidentified couple in the collection of Elizabeth "Bessie" Smeaton (1886-1979) of Inglewood. #Caledon

Here's Cyrus Brown, a carriage horse breeder of Meadowvale, ca. 1890. His clients included the Governor General of Canada.

A wintery photo of the butcher shop at Summerville, Dundas Street at Etobicoke Creek. Built in 1898 by Joe Culham. #Mississauga

Groundhog Day was created in 1886 in the US, an update of Candlemas. The first mention in #Brampton 's The Conservator newspaper was in 1893, but it wasn't mentioned again until 1938.

Before he was an icon of Canadian television on @tvotoday.bsky.social, "Saturday Night at the Movies" host Elwy Yost had a column in AVRO Newsmagazine. He worked in their personnel department from 1953 until 1959.

In 1894 a young girl memorialized her visit to the site of the Battle of Queenston Heights. Major-General Sir Isaac Brock died in this 1812 victory against invading Americans which helped establish Canadian self-identity.

Mary Manning fonds, Region of Peel Archives.
